在当今数字时代,图像处理和识别技术已经渗透到我们生活的方方面面。从智能手机的摄影功能,到智能监控系统的安全监控,再到医学影像的诊断,图像识别技术发挥着至关重要的作用。本文将深度解析八大图像识别模型,揭示它们背后的科技奥秘。
一、图像识别概述
图像识别是指计算机通过分析图像的像素、颜色、形状等特征,对图像中的目标对象进行识别或分类的过程。常见的图像识别任务包括物体检测和分类、人脸识别、图像特征提取等。
二、八大图像识别模型
1. 边缘检测
边缘检测是图像处理的基础步骤,通过算法识别图像中的边缘,有助于后续的特征提取和图像分割。常见的边缘检测算法有Canny算子、Sobel算子等。
2. 特征提取
特征提取是从图像中提取关键特征的过程,为后续的图像识别和分类打下基础。常见的特征提取方法有HOG(Histogram of Oriented Gradients)、SIFT(Scale-Invariant Feature Transform)等。
3. 支持向量机(SVM)
SVM是一种有效的图像分类方法,通过找到不同类别之间的最佳边界来识别图像。SVM在图像识别任务中表现出色,尤其适用于小样本学习。
4. 决策树
决策树通过一系列的判断条件来简化决策过程,用于图像分类和识别任务。决策树具有易于理解、解释性强等优点。
5. 卷积神经网络(CNN)
CNN是深度学习的代表性模型,在图像识别任务中表现出色。CNN能够自动学习图像的层次特征,广泛应用于目标检测、图像分类、图像分割等领域。
6. R-CNN
R-CNN是一种基于深度学习的目标检测算法,通过在图像上滑动窗口并提取窗口内的特征,实现目标检测和分类。
7. YOLO
YOLO(You Only Look Once)是一种实时目标检测算法,具有速度快、准确率高、易于实现等优点。YOLO通过将图像划分为多个网格,在每个网格上预测目标的位置和类别。
8. SSD
SSD(Single Shot MultiBox Detector)是一种基于深度学习的目标检测算法,通过单次预测实现目标检测和分类。SSD具有速度快、准确率高、参数较少等优点。
三、总结
本文对八大图像识别模型进行了深度解析,揭示了它们背后的科技奥秘。随着深度学习技术的不断发展,图像识别技术在各个领域的应用将越来越广泛,为我们的生活带来更多便利。